The Observatory was a Kraus-type radio telescope, named for Dr. John D. Kraus, the founder and director of the observatory, who was also the designer and builder of the telescope. Big Ear covered an area larger than three football fields. The telescope was famous for discovering some of the most distant known objects in the universe, as well as ...modeling job pack. Pro Game Guides is supported by our audience. When you purchase through links on our site, we may earn a small ...Radio Telescope Calibration SRT: The SRT has xed parameters for the receiver. It takes packets of 64 time samples and does a 64-bin FFT. The sample rate is xed at 5:00 105=s giving a bandwidth of 500kHz. Thus each FFT bin is 7812.5Hz wide. The gain of the receiver is xed. You need to finish your Flying Lesson, and this activity costs around $165 for 10 hours.This study presents a general outline of the Qitai radio telescope (QTT) project. Qitai, the site of the telescope, is a county of Xinjiang Uygur Autonomous Region of China, located in the east Tianshan Mountains at an elevation of about 1800 m. The QTT is a fully steerable, Gregorian-type telescope with a standard parabolic main reflector of 110 m diameter. While …e-MERLIN is an array of seven radio telescopes spanning 217 km (135 miles) across Great Britain connected by a superfast optical fibre network to its headquarters at Jodrell Bank Observatory. EDGES is a long-term collaboration between MIT Haystack Observatory and Arizona State University, funded by the National Science Foundation (NSF). It is located at the Murchison Radio-astronomy Observatory (MRO) in a radio-quiet zone in western Australia, with onsite infrastructure support provided by Australia’s CSIRO..
